This Webinar will present practical flight control system design methods for aircraft and rotorcraft UAVs and illustrate these methods with flight-test case studies. First, the optimization-based approach to practical flight control design using CONDUIT® will be presented, with special emphasis on UAV applications. The majority of the webinar will present detailed case studies demonstrating methods and flight test results for full-scale and sub-scale UAVs. Recent case studies of multi-copter UAVs will be highlighted, since these configurations are receiving a lot of current interest in the UAV community.

The Internet of Things (IoT), as defined by the International Telecommunications Union, is “a global infrastructure for the information society, enabling advanced services by interconnecting (physical and virtual) things based on existing and evolving interoperable information and communication technologies”. IoT may generate new customer-serving and revenue-generating opportunities at airports, optimize airport operations, and create efficiencies that could impact various stakeholders.

Tail Assignment and Aircraft Routing are two very powerful tools to help your airline proactively plan and develop more efficient and robust schedules.Aircraft Routing balances passenger booking information, crew requirements and maintenance constraints to deliver the most efficient aircraft routing options.Tail Assignment considers each aircraft’s specific operating costs and operational constraints to allocate the most optimal tail to each aircraft.

How can the Internet of Things be used to improve drivers’ parking experience? Is it possible to make it easier to spot a free parking space in a garage? The AUTOPILOT webinar on 31 May 2018 explored these questions and many more. The second in the AUTOPILOT webinar series, it was hosted by TNO and focused on the work being done at the AUTOPILOT test site in Brainport, Eindhoven region.
